Abstract:
Use of scalp skin for facial organ reconstruction represents a mainstream procedure for organ reconstruction. In most cases, adequate amounts of skin can be obtained by using tissue expanders, but harvesting sufficient scalp tissue in patients with low hairlines is challenging. Hair follicular unit extraction (FUE) is one approach to resolve this problem. With FUE, hair follicles are removed from the scalp skin, which can then be prepared as a donor site to obtain sufficient amounts of hairless skin.
To evaluate the safety and efficacy of FUE when combined with an expanded scalp flap for facial organ reconstruction.
Patients with low hairlines requiring facial organ reconstruction were selected for this study. The area of skin extension and hair removal were determined prior to surgery, a process which was performed in three stages. Stage I consisted of hair follicle removal using the FUE technique at the donor site. Stage II involved expander implantation using water injections. In Stage III facial organ reconstruction was completed.
With the use of the FUE technique, hair follicles from the donor scalp were thoroughly removed and the donor scalp tissue was successfully expanded. Postoperatively, no evident scar formation at the reconstruction site or contracture of the expanded flap was observed. All patients were satisfied with the outcome of their reconstruction procedure.
FUE provides a means for hair follicle removal from the donor site and can be employed to achieve a safe and effective procedure for facial reconstruction in patients with low hairlines.
摘要:
背景:使用头皮皮肤进行面部器官重建是器官重建的主流程序。在大多数情况下,通过使用组织扩张器可以获得足够量的皮肤,但是在低发际线患者中采集足够的头皮组织是具有挑战性的。毛囊单位提取(FUE)是解决该问题的一种方法。有了FUE,从头皮皮肤上去除毛囊,然后可以将其制备为供体部位以获得足够量的无毛皮肤。
目的:评价FUE联合扩张头皮皮瓣重建面部器官的安全性和有效性。
方法:选择需要面部器官重建的低发际线患者进行本研究。手术前确定皮肤延伸和脱毛的面积,分三个阶段进行的过程。阶段I包括在供体部位使用FUE技术去除毛囊。第二阶段涉及使用注水的扩张器植入。在第三阶段,面部器官重建已完成。
结果:使用FUE技术,彻底去除供体头皮的毛囊,并成功扩大供体头皮组织。术后,在重建部位未观察到明显的瘢痕形成或扩张皮瓣挛缩。所有患者对其重建程序的结果感到满意。
结论:FUE提供了一种从供体部位去除毛囊的方法,可用于实现低发际线患者面部重建的安全有效程序。
